It is with great pleasure that we invite you to participate in the 23rd Annual Workshop on Applications and Generalizations of Complex Analysis, to be held at the University of Aveiro on March 27-28, 2026.
As customary, we will have invited communications (about 45 min) and short communications (about 20 min).
We would be glad if you would decide to participate and even more if you could provide a contribution.
